excel加载宏为什么不能用
作者:路由通
|
365人看过
发布时间:2026-02-15 06:41:51
标签:
加载宏是电子表格软件中用于扩展功能的重要工具,但用户常遇到其无法启用或运行的困扰。究其原因,主要涉及安全设置限制、文件格式兼容性问题、代码编写错误、软件版本差异以及系统环境配置不当等多个层面。本文将深入剖析这十二个核心因素,并提供相应的诊断思路与解决方案,帮助您彻底理解和解决加载宏失效的难题。
在日常使用电子表格软件处理复杂数据或自动化任务时,加载宏无疑是一把利器。它能将一系列操作封装起来,实现功能的定制与扩展。然而,许多用户都曾遭遇过这样的窘境:精心准备或下载的加载宏文件,无论如何尝试都无法正常启用或运行,屏幕上只留下令人困惑的错误提示或一片沉寂。这背后并非单一原因所致,而是一个由软件设置、文件本身、系统环境等多方面因素交织而成的复杂网络。理解这些原因,是解决问题的第一步。接下来,我们将逐一拆解导致加载宏失效的十二个关键环节。
安全中心设置阻拦 现代电子表格软件出于防范恶意代码的考虑,内置了严格的安全机制。默认情况下,软件的安全中心会阻止所有来自互联网或不受信任位置的加载宏运行。如果您直接从网络下载宏文件并尝试打开,很可能会看到一个安全警告栏,提示“已禁用宏”。这是软件最基础、也最常见的保护措施。要解决此问题,您需要手动调整信任中心设置,将包含该加载宏文件的文件夹添加为受信任位置,或者临时降低宏安全级别。但务必注意,降低安全级别需谨慎,应确保文件来源绝对可靠。 文件格式与扩展名不匹配 加载宏有其特定的文件格式。标准的加载宏文件扩展名应为“.xlam”(适用于较新版本)或“.xla”(适用于较旧版本)。有时,文件可能在保存、重命名或传输过程中出现了问题,导致其实际格式与扩展名不符。例如,一个本质上是普通工作簿的文件被强行改名为“.xlam”,软件自然无法将其识别为有效的加载宏。您可以通过右键点击文件查看属性,或尝试用压缩软件打开(因为这类文件本质上是压缩包)来初步判断其真实格式。确保文件以正确的格式保存至关重要。 代码存在编译或运行时错误 加载宏的核心是其内部封装的代码(通常使用Visual Basic for Applications编写)。如果代码本身存在语法错误、逻辑缺陷,或引用了不存在的对象、库,那么在尝试加载或执行时就会失败。软件可能会弹出编译错误对话框,提示具体的错误行和原因;也可能在运行时 silently fail(静默失败),没有任何提示但功能无法实现。排查这类问题需要一定的编程知识,可以尝试在开发工具中打开代码编辑器,使用“调试”功能逐行检查,或查看是否有缺失的引用库。 软件版本或位数不兼容 不同版本的电子表格软件,其对象模型、支持的功能和文件格式可能存在差异。一个为旧版本(如2007版)编写的加载宏,在新版本(如2021版或365版)中可能无法完美运行,反之亦然。更隐蔽的问题是位数不匹配:如果您的软件是64位版本,而加载宏中包含了为32位环境编译的特定组件或动态链接库声明,就可能导致加载失败。通常,错误信息会提及“兼容性”或“找不到DLL文件”。解决方法是寻找与您软件版本和位数匹配的加载宏,或联系开发者进行更新适配。 数字签名无效或缺失 为了进一步确保安全性,许多企业环境或高安全要求的设置中,会要求加载宏必须具有有效的数字签名。数字签名相当于文件的“身份证”,由可信任的证书颁发机构签发,用于证明文件的来源和完整性。如果加载宏没有签名,或签名已过期、被吊销、来自不受信任的发布者,安全设置可能会阻止其加载。您可以在文件的“属性”对话框中查看数字签名详情。若因签名问题受阻,您需要获取带有有效签名的版本,或者(在明确知晓风险的前提下)在信任中心将发布者添加为受信任的发布者。 加载项管理器中的冲突或禁用状态 所有已安装的加载宏都会在软件的“加载项”列表中管理。有时,加载宏虽然文件存在,但可能处于未被勾选的“禁用”状态。此外,如果两个不同的加载宏尝试修改同一个菜单项或功能,可能会发生冲突,导致其中一个或两者都无法正常工作。您可以依次点击“文件”、“选项”、“加载项”,在底部的“管理”下拉框中选择“Excel加载项”,然后点击“转到”按钮,查看并管理加载项列表。确保目标加载宏已被勾选,并留意是否有名称相似的冲突项。 必需的引用库未被正确注册或丢失 复杂的加载宏除了自身的代码,往往还依赖于外部库文件,例如某些特定的动态链接库、ActiveX控件或其他组件。如果这些依赖库没有在您的操作系统中正确注册,或者根本不存在于您的电脑上,加载宏在启动时就会失败。错误信息通常包含“无法找到对象库”或“运行时错误‘429’”等字样。解决此问题需要识别加载宏所依赖的库,并手动在系统上安装和注册它们。这可能需要一定的技术支持,或向加载宏的开发者索取完整的安装包。 文件本身已损坏 文件在存储、下载或传输过程中可能因磁盘错误、网络中断、病毒破坏等原因而损坏。一个损坏的加载宏文件可能无法被软件正常解析。您可以尝试重新从原始来源下载或复制该文件。如果文件是您自己创建的,可以尝试从备份中恢复。另外,电子表格文件本质上是压缩的XML文件包,可以尝试将其扩展名临时改为“.zip”,然后用解压软件打开,检查内部文件结构是否完整。如果解压过程报错或内部文件乱码,基本可以断定文件已损坏。 用户权限不足 在受管理的企业网络环境中,用户的电脑操作权限可能受到严格限制。安装或运行加载宏通常需要向系统目录写入文件或修改注册表,这些操作都需要管理员权限。如果您的账户是标准用户,没有足够的权限,那么加载过程会被操作系统或组策略阻止。症状可能是加载宏列表无法保存更改,或者运行时提示“权限被拒绝”。这种情况下,您需要联系系统管理员,请求临时提升权限以完成安装,或者将加载宏部署到您拥有写入权限的目录(如用户文档文件夹)。 与其它插件或安全软件冲突 您的电脑上可能安装了其他第三方插件或安全软件(如杀毒软件、防火墙)。这些软件有时会过度敏感,将加载宏的行为误判为恶意活动并进行拦截。例如,某些杀毒软件会实时扫描并隔离包含宏代码的文件。您可以尝试暂时禁用杀毒软件的实时保护功能(操作后请尽快恢复),然后再次尝试加载,以判断是否为此类冲突。同时,也应检查是否安装了其他电子表格增强工具,它们之间可能存在资源争夺或功能覆盖,导致新加载宏无法正常挂接。 安装路径包含中文字符或特殊字符 这是一个容易被忽略但确实存在的问题。某些旧版代码或依赖库对文件路径的兼容性不佳,如果加载宏文件被放置在包含中文字符、全角符号或特殊字符(如“&”、“”)的文件夹路径下,可能会导致程序在定位或读取文件时出错。建议将加载宏文件移动到一个路径简单、仅由英文字母和数字组成的目录中,例如“C:ExcelAddIns”,然后再尝试通过加载项管理器进行添加和安装。 软件本身安装不完整或损坏 最后,问题可能并非出在加载宏上,而是电子表格软件本身。如果软件的核心组件或Visual Basic for Applications引擎在安装时受损,或者后续更新失败,都可能导致所有依赖宏的功能异常。您可以尝试运行软件自带的修复功能(通常在控制面板的“程序和功能”中找到对应项目,选择“更改”然后“修复”)。如果修复无效,在备份好个人文件和数据后,彻底卸载并重新安装软件,往往是解决此类底层问题的终极方法。 综上所述,加载宏无法使用是一个多因素问题,从软件的安全策略到代码质量,从系统环境到文件本身,任何一个环节出问题都可能导致功能失效。在遇到问题时,建议您按照从易到难的顺序进行排查:首先检查最明显的安全警告和加载项列表;其次确认文件格式和完整性;再逐步深入到代码、依赖和权限层面。理解这十二个关键点,就如同掌握了十二把钥匙,能帮助您系统地打开加载宏失效这把锁,让强大的自动化工具重新为您所用。希望这篇深入的分析能切实解决您工作中遇到的困扰。
相关文章
在数字世界中,文件格式是信息存储与交换的基石。“rw”作为一种文件扩展名,其含义并非单一,而是根据具体的技术语境和应用领域有所不同。本文将深入剖析“rw”格式在不同场景下的具体指代,从早期的编程语言数据文件,到地理信息系统中的专业格式,乃至开源社区中的特定应用。通过追溯其历史渊源、解析其技术特性、探讨其实际应用场景,并结合官方权威资料,为您呈现一个关于“rw”格式的全面、专业且实用的深度解读,帮助您准确识别并有效处理此类文件。
2026-02-15 06:41:41
298人看过
电压是电力系统中的基本参数,其稳定与否深刻影响着从大型工业设备到日常家用电器的方方面面。电压的改变,无论是升高还是降低,都会引发一系列连锁反应,它不仅关乎电气设备的使用寿命与运行效率,更与电能质量、系统安全乃至经济成本紧密相连。本文将深入探讨电压变化对各类用电设备、电力系统本身以及最终用户产生的多重影响,为您揭示这一看似抽象的参数背后所蕴含的实用意义。
2026-02-15 06:41:26
275人看过
低压电流,通常指电压在1000伏特(交流)或1500伏特(直流)以下的电气系统中流动的电流。它是我们日常生活和绝大多数工业应用中最常接触的电力形式,从家庭照明到工厂设备驱动,其身影无处不在。理解低压电流的定义、特性、应用场景与安全规范,对于安全用电、优化能源使用以及推动技术发展至关重要。本文将从多个维度,为您深入剖析这一看似寻常却内涵丰富的概念。
2026-02-15 06:41:26
275人看过
接地带,这个听起来有些专业甚至陌生的词汇,其实与我们的电气安全、电子设备稳定乃至生命财产安全息息相关。它并非一根简单的导线,而是一个涉及原理、标准、材料与施工的系统性安全工程概念。本文将深入浅出,从基础定义出发,层层剖析接地带的构成、核心功能、不同类型、技术标准以及在实际住宅、工业场景中的应用要点,旨在为您提供一份全面、权威且实用的指南,帮助您构建起关于电气安全接地的清晰认知框架。
2026-02-15 06:41:23
389人看过
许多用户在使用文字处理软件时,会疑惑为何找不到直接的“标色”功能,这与他们对文档标记习惯的理解存在偏差。本文将从软件设计初衷、核心功能定位、排版逻辑以及替代方案等多个维度,深入剖析这一现象背后的深层原因。我们将探讨文字处理与图形标注的本质区别,解析内置高亮与字体颜色功能的实际用途,并介绍如何利用批注、绘图工具及数字墨水等实现高效标记,最终帮助读者掌握在文档中实现各类标记需求的正确方法。
2026-02-15 06:40:52
172人看过
作为微软办公套件中的经典文字处理组件,Word 2003凭借其强大的兼容性,能够处理多种格式的文件。它不仅完美支持自身生成的文档格式,还能打开、编辑并保存来自其他文字处理软件、网页乃至早期版本的文件。本文将系统性地剖析Word 2003所支持编辑的核心文件类型,涵盖其原生格式、通用交换格式、网页相关格式及其他特殊格式,并深入探讨其跨版本兼容与有限的文件创建能力,旨在为用户提供一份全面而实用的操作指南。
2026-02-15 06:40:39
60人看过
热门推荐
资讯中心:
.webp)

.webp)
.webp)
.webp)
.webp)